Steamed Anchovy
Steamed anchovy is a small, nutrient-dense fish known for its rich flavor and high omega-3 fatty acid content. It is an excellent source of protein, vitamins, and minerals, making it a healthy addition to various diets.
•R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which support heart health and reduce inflammation.
•High protein content aids in muscle repair and growth.
Alaska Plaice Fillet
Alaska plaice fillet is a lean, white fish known for its delicate flavor and flaky texture. It is rich in protein and low in fat, making it a healthy choice for various culinary preparations.
•High in protein, which is essential for muscle repair and growth.
•Rich in omega-3 fatty acids that support heart health and reduce inflammation.
